Rebar Estimating Services: Precision Cost Solutions for Reinforced Concrete Projects

Rebar estimating services calculate the quantity, placement, and costs of reinforcing steel bars (rebar) required for concrete structures like foundations, columns, slabs, and walls. These services ensure precise material takeoffs, labor allocations, and compliance with engineering specifications, preventing costly over-ordering or structural weaknesses.

Key Factors in Rebar Estimation

  1. Rebar Size & Grade: #3 to #18 bars, with grades like ASTM A615 or A706.

  2. Shape Complexity: Straight bars, stirrups, or custom bends (e.g., hooks, chairs).

  3. Labor Costs: Cutting, bending, and tying rebar (5 per pound installed).

  4. Waste Factor: Add 5–10% for cuts, overlaps, and errors.

  5. Project Scale: High-rises require more precise scheduling than residential slabs.

Rebar Estimating Process

  1. Review Structural Drawings: Analyze blueprints for rebar size, spacing, and placement.

  2. Quantity Takeoff: Use tools like AutoCADRevit, or Planswift to measure linear feet and count bends.

  3. Cost Calculation: Apply current rebar prices (0.30–0.80 per pound) and labor rates.

  4. Clash Detection: Ensure rebar doesn’t conflict with MEP systems using BIM.

  5. Final Report: Deliver detailed PDF/Excel files with material lists, costs, and installation guidelines.

FAQs: Rebar Estimating Simplified

How is rebar quantity calculated?

Linear feet × weight per foot (e.g., #4 rebar = 0.668 lbs/ft).
